What is the process called that involves the movement of particles from regions of higher density to regions of lower density?

The process of moving particles from regions of higher density to regions of lower density is known as diffusion. This phenomenon occurs as particles naturally spread out to achieve an even concentration throughout a given area. In diffusion, no energy is required; instead, particles move due to their kinetic energy, which causes them to collide and spread apart. This process is vital in many biological and physical systems, such as the exchange of gases in the lungs or the mixing of substances in solutions.

Osmosis specifically describes the movement of water molecules through a semi-permeable membrane from an area of lower solute concentration to an area of higher solute concentration, which is a subset of diffusion but does not encompass the broader definition of particle movement referred to in the question.

Active transport, on the other hand, involves the movement of particles against their concentration gradient, which requires energy input, typically in the form of ATP. This process is different from diffusion as it is not driven by the natural tendency to move from high to low concentration.

Filtration is distinct as it involves the passage of fluids and solutes through a filter or membrane driven by pressure differences, which is a different mechanism than the spontaneous dispersion of particles characteristic of diffusion.
